Senior Accounts Payable Specialist

The Senior Accounts Payable Specialist is responsible for overseeing the full-cycle accounts payable process while ensuring accuracy, compliance, and timely payment of invoices. This role serves as a subject-matter expert within AP, supports process improvements, and may mentor junior AP staff. The ideal candidate is detail-oriented, organized, and comfortable working in a fast-paced environment.

Key Responsibilities

Manage full-cycle accounts payable, including invoice processing, coding, approvals, and payment runs

Review and approve invoices for accuracy, proper documentation, and compliance with company policies

Handle complex and high-volume AP transactions, including recurring and accrual-based invoices

Reconcile vendor statements and resolve discrepancies and payment issues in a timely manner

Maintain vendor records, including W-9s and 1099 reporting support

Assist with month-end close activities, including AP accruals and reconciliations

Partner with internal departments and external vendors to address inquiries and resolve issues

Support audits by providing AP documentation and responding to auditor requests

Identify opportunities for process improvement and increased efficiency within AP operations

Mentor and provide guidance to junior AP staff as needed
